Description:
A more in-depth study of the areas of Psychology. An extension of introduction of Psychology that is ideal for students who plan to major or minor in Psychology, complete the ETS GRE subject test in Psychology or that have a science- teaching, scientific or library arts orientation. A focus is placed on interpretation and reconstruction of psychological knowledge. Pre-requisite: RPS211. Previous Course ID: RPS221
